About Soller

Set in lush orange groves between the mountains and the sea

There are a couple of ways to reach the old Mallorcan town of Sóller. You can drive through the stunning Tamuntana mountains, if approaching from the north, or join the vintage, 1912, Pullman train at the Plaza España in Palma, and wind your way through some wonderful scenic countryside. Either way, the journey is an experience topped off by visiting a very typical Mallorcan town. The Plaza Constitució has an abundance of cafes, where you can enjoy a glass of fresh orange juice and ensaimada or coffee. The area comes alive on Saturday morning when the local market takes place. A visit to Can Prunera art gallery, not only allows you the chance to see a permanent collection of works by national and international artists such as, Picasso, Miró and Rusiñol, but the building that houses the collection too, an architectural gem built between 1909 and 1911. Sóller has been inhabited by humans since Talayotice times (5200BC), and remains from this era include bronze statues, two of which can be found in the Museu de Mallorca in Palma. During the 19th century, Sóller became a major exporter of olives and citrus fruits. Sóller Botanical Gardens, can be found on the MA11 just outside Sóller. It´s main purpose is to preserve rare and endangered species of the Balearics. Well worth a visit!
